About the Game

Oh Deer is a multiplayer hide-and-seek game where one player plays as a hunter and up to four others play as deer.

Hunter Role

The hunter's role is to use sound, gadgets, and pure skill to locate and eliminate the other players before nightfall. However, knowing if the deer in your sights is a player or not is the true challenge.

Deer Role

The Deer's role is to hide from the hunter by blending in with a handful of AI deer scattered around the map. Eating food is a priority to keep hunger at bay. But improper timing when eating could mean the difference between life and death.

The Map

Forests are the perfect place to hide. With lots of trees, bushes, and cute flowers, deer can live happily for years without any worries. That is, until hunting season begins... Tall trees, thick bushes, and plenty of shade sets up a perfect ambush.
